Average Metal-Refining Furnace Operators and Tenders Salary in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N

The average salary for a Metal-Refining Furnace Operators and Tenders in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N is $59,600.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N has 0.93x the national average concentration of Metal-Refining Furnace Operators and Tenders jobs. This means there are fewer opportunities per capita here compared to the U.S. average — competition for roles may be higher.

130 people work as Metal-Refining Furnace Operators and Tenders in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N.

Only 0.123 out of every 1,000 local jobs are Metal-Refining Furnace Operators and Tenders roles — this is a niche profession in the area.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 130 employees in the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N area with a job density of 0.123 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
